You will Receive:25 Ají Dulce Seeds (Sweet Pepper) 25 Ají Caballero Seeds (Gentlemen Pepper, spicy, picante)These seeds are 100% Grown and Shipped from Puerto RicoAjí DulceAppearance: Ají dulce peppers are small, typically 1-3 inches long, and have a wrinkled, glossy skin. They are often yellow, orange, or red when ripe.Flavor: They have a mild, sweet flavor with a slight heat, making them distinct from hotter peppers. They’re not overwhelmingly spicy, which makes them versatile in cooking.Culinary Uses: Ají dulce is commonly used in traditional Puerto Rican dishes, such as sofrito, a base for many stews, rice dishes, and sauces. They add flavor without too much heat, making them ideal for various recipes.Nutritional Value: Like many peppers, ají dulce peppers are rich in vitamins A and C, providing antioxidant benefits.Ají Caballero Appearance:Ají Caballero peppers are small to medium sized, typically around 2 to 5 inches long.They have a vibrant orange or red color when ripe and a slightly wrinkled skin.Ají Caballero is cherished in Puerto Rican cooking for its balance of sweetness and heat, making it an essential ingredient in many traditional recipes. Flavor Profile:These peppers have a sweet, fruity flavor with a moderate level of heat, making them versatile in cooking.They are often compared to ají dulce but are generally spicier. Culinary Uses:Commonly used in sofrito, a flavorful base for many Puerto Rican dishes, such as rice, beans, and stews.They can be used fresh in salads, salsas, or pickled for added flavor.Ají Caballero peppers can also be used in marinades and sauces to enhance dishes. Nutritional Value:Rich in vitamins A and C, as well as antioxidants, ají caballero peppers provide health benefits alongside their culinary uses. 100 FRESH HEIRLOOM ROMAINE LETTUCE SEEDSPARRIS ISLAND COSFREE USA SHIPPINGBUY ANY 4 PACKAGES GET 1 FREE OF SELLERS CHOICEVegetable Description: Parris Island Cos, a Romaine type heirloom lettuce named for an island off the cost of South Carolina, was introduced 1952. Wild lettuce, however, from which modern lettuce is derived, originated in Asia Minor. The ancient historian Herodotus records its presence on the tables of 6th century Persian kings, and throughout the following centuries it became a popular crop all over Europe. Columbus brought it with him to the New World, starting its spread over the North American continent. Without a doubt, lettuce now holds a place in nearly every garden on the globe.Vegetable Botanical Name: Lactuca sativa Vegetable Duration: AnnualVegetable Days to Maturity: 70Vegetable Height: 6” to 18”Vegetable Spacing: 9 in to 12 inVegetable Planting: Direct sow outside in early spring. Varieties differ on how long they take to mature, ranging from 45 to 60 days on average. Plan to direct-sow seeds in the garden about two to four weeks prior to your area’s last projected frost date in the spring. The soil temperature should be between 45 and 65°F. You can plant again in the fall once the temperature cools, though make sure there’s enough time for your variety to reach maturity before freezing weather arrives. Pick a spot that gets full sun, though some afternoon shade is OK. Make sure no nearby larger plants will leaf out in the spring and shade your lettuce too much. The soil should be loose and well-draining. Container growth is also an option if you don’t have the right garden space. The seeds need light to germinate, so just slightly press them into the soil. Rows should be spaced 12 inches apart. Butterhead lettuce grows best in full sun, meaning at least six hours of direct sun per day. But it can tolerate partial shade. And in hot climates, it will appreciate shade from the strong afternoon sun. Like all lettuces, butterhead does well in an average to rich, loamy or somewhat sandy soil. Lettuce can succumb to rot in heavy clay or other poorly drained soils. So if this describes your soil, consider container culture or amend your soil to improve it. A slightly acidic to neutral soil pH is best. Keep the soil consistently moist from planting until harvest. The ideal moisture level will have your soil feeling like a wrung-out sponge. Butterhead lettuce grows best in cool to moderate temperatures between 45 – 80°F. Long days of increased light and temperatures above 80°F will signal your butterhead to bolt, which diminishes its flavor.
